403 Forbiddenエラーページの解説と対処法|ウェブサイト運営者必見の情報

インターネットを利用していると、「403 Forbidden」エラーに遭遇することがあります。このエラーは、アクセスしようとしたページやリソースに対して許可がない場合に表示され、ユーザーやウェブサイト管理者にとっては避けて通れない問題です。この記事では、403 Forbiddenエラーの背景や原因、そして効果的な対処方法について詳しく解説します。特に、ウェブサイト運営者や開発者にとって重要なポイントを押さえ、迅速かつ適切に解決できる知識を提供します。このエラーの理解と対処法を身につけることで、ユーザーエクスペリエンスの向上やウェブサイトの安定性を保つことが可能です。さらに、403 Forbiddenエラーが発生した際の具体的な対応策や、事前に防ぐための予防策についても紹介します。この記事を通じて、403 Forbiddenエラーに悩む方やウェブサイトの運営に携わる方々が、よりスムーズに問題を解決できるようになることを目指します。

403 Forbiddenエラーは、アクセス権の設定ミスやセキュリティ設定の誤り、またはサーバーの設定問題など、さまざまな原因で発生します。そのため、原因の特定と正しい対応策を講じることが重要です。本記事では、具体的な事例や問題解決の手順を詳しく解説し、自身のウェブサイトに適した対応策を見つけられるようサポートします。適切な知識と対処法を身につけることで、ウェブサイトの信頼性やユーザー満足度を向上させることが可能です。

403 Forbiddenエラーの詳細な内容と背景

403 Forbiddenエラーは、HTTPステータスコードの一つで、サーバーがクライアントのリクエストを理解したものの、そのリクエストに対してアクセスを許可しない場合に返されます。こうした状況は、多くの場合、望ましくないアクセス制限やセキュリティ設定の結果です。例えば、特定のIPアドレスからのアクセス制限、アクセス権の不正な設定、またはディレクトリの権限が不適切な場合に発生します。

ウェブサイトの運営側は、セキュリティ上の理由からアクセス制限を設けることがありますが、これが誤設定で正当なユーザーのアクセスを妨げるケースもあります。また、.htaccessファイルやサーバーの設定ミスも原因となることがあります。さらに、ユーザー側のブラウザのキャッシュやクッキーの問題も、403 Forbiddenエラーを引き起こす場合があります。

403 Forbiddenエラーの原因と対処法の概要

原因は多岐にわたりますが、最も一般的なものは以下の通りです:

  • アクセス権限の誤設定
  • IPアドレスや地域によるアクセス制限
  • .htaccessやサーバー設定の誤り
  • ファイルまたはディレクトリの権限設定ミス
  • セキュリティプラグインやファイアウォールの設定
  • ユーザーのブラウザやネットワークの問題

これらの原因を特定し、適切な対処を行うことが、問題解決の鍵となります。次に、具体的な解決法について詳しく解説します。

403 Forbiddenエラーの具体的な解決策と予防策

原因の特定

最初に、サーバーログを確認してエラーの詳細な原因を調査します。

アクセス権設定や.htaccessの内容、サーバー設定ファイルを見直すことが必要です。場合によっては、最新版のブラウザでアクセスし直す、クッキーやキャッシュをクリアすることで解決することもあります。

アクセス権の設定の見直し

FTPやホスティングコントロールパネルを使用して、対象ディレクトリやファイルの権限設定を適切に修正します。一般的な設定は、ディレクトリは755、ファイルは644です。

.htaccessファイルの確認と設定修正

.htaccessファイル内に誤ったリダイレクトやアクセス制御のルールがないか確認し、必要に応じて修正します。また、不要な制限や誤った記述を削除します。

セキュリティプラグインやファイアウォールの調整

セキュリティプラグインやウェブアプリケーションファイアウォール(WAF)の設定を見直し、不適切な制限を解除します。アクセス制限ルールを適切に設定し、正当なアクセスを妨げないようにしましょう。

サーバーの設定やアップデート

サーバーの設定変更やアップデートを定期的に行い、セキュリティリスクを最小限に抑えます。必要であれば、ホスティングプロバイダや技術サポートに相談することも有効です。

ユーザー側の対策

ブラウザのキャッシュやクッキーをクリアし、ネットワーク設定を確認してください。VPNやプロキシを利用している場合は、それらを無効にしてアクセスを試みることも効果的です。

403 Forbiddenエラーの予防と管理

事前にエラーを防ぐためには、適切なアクセス権とセキュリティ設定を維持し、サーバーやウェブアプリケーションの定期的なメンテナンスと監査を行うことが重要です。また、複数のバックアップを保持し、設定変更の前には必ずバックアップを取る習慣をつけましょう。これにより、万が一エラーが発生しても迅速に復旧が可能です。

まとめ

403 Forbiddenエラーは、アクセス権や設定のミスから生じる一般的なウェブ問題であり、適切な原因分析と対策を通じて解決可能です。この記事で紹介した具体的な解決策を実践し、サイトのセキュリティとユーザーエクスペリエンスの向上を図りましょう。問題が解決しない場合は、専門家やサポートに相談することも検討してください。ウェブサイト運営の安心と安全を確保し、トラブルなくオンラインビジネスや情報発信を続けていくために、エラー対応の知識を身につけておくことが非常に重要です。

TOP